Quote:
Originally Posted by int2str View Post
... and the color of the stitching. "Performance" wheel has white stiching, "M-Performance" has "///M" stitching.



I don't think that's true. The "Performance" steering wheel (shown above) has the yellow stripe. The "///M Performance" steering wheel has the blue stripe with the M colored stitching. I don't think they make a red one from factory.

Here's the ///M Performance wheel in my car:

Yep, the M Performance version(blue stripe) has the tri-color ///M stitching vs. the white stitching on the Performance wheel w/ the yellow stripe.

There actually is an M Performance wheel available with a red stripe, but it's specifically for the new F30 3 Series models shown here.
